Our History
|
| |
Antibióticos do Brasil was created in January 2003, when the American
multinational Eli Lilly of Brazil segmented its businesses into patented
and non-patented products. Since then ABL acquired the whole line of
hospital products
once owned by Eli Lilly, including one of the world’s most advanced plants
in the production of cephalosporin antibiotics.With a staff of 320
qualified professionals, ABL is proud to hold high standards of quality
and commitment to the customer, who was always the focus of the company.
In April 2003, ABL was incorporated into the
Italian group ACS Dobfar. One of the biggest companies on
the world market of APIs in the production of cephalosporin products. ACS
Dobfar has sales of 600 million dollars,approximately 1200 employees
and it’s been on the market for over 30 years.It presently owns 11 factories:
08 in Italy, one in Brazil, one in Switzerland and one in Korea.
ABL’s plant in Brazil is located 200 kilometers northwest of São Paulo
in a small town called Cosmópolis and its two sales offices are in São
Paulo and Rio de Janeiro. ABL’s focus is on the production of
injectable and oral cephalosporin antibiotics for the local and
international markets. With an income of 42 million dollars in 2004
and investments passing the mark of 60 million dollars since its
opening in 1982 then owned by Eli Lilly. ABL represents one of the
main companies in Brazil with know-how and assured quality to export
antibiotics to highly demanding markets, such as:
Argentina, Azerbaijan, Canada, Chile, China, Colombia, Costa Rica, Croacia / Eslovenia, Dominican Republic, Ecuador, El Salvador, France, Greece, Honduras, Hong Kong, Italian, Japan, Mexico, Nicaragua, Panama, Peru, South Africa, South Korea, Switzerland, Taiwan, Turkey, USA and Venezuela
